## Autoscaler Approvals

External plugins cannot modify Quillhook's queue-depth autoscaler directly. Changes to scaling thresholds, cooldown windows, or depth metrics require a written approval request. Submit the request with expected load impact and a rollback plan. Requests without load numbers are rejected. Emergency overrides follow the same path, expedited. All approvals for the queue-depth autoscaler are granted solely by the person named below.

account owner for bawip-tahag: Raleth Quenok

- [ ] **Step 7: Breaker override escrow.** After sealing the signing keys for the Tallgrove upstream API circuit breaker, confirm the support team can force the breaker open during a full outage. The override bundle lives in the sealed escrow drawer and is useless without its unlock phrase. Two ceremony witnesses must initial this step before proceeding. The escrow bundle is decrypted with the recovery passphrase that follows.

vault phrase of kahip-kahop = holath-quenmir

### Step 4: Reconfigure the sweeper

After upgrading to Clearbin 3.x, the retention sweeper no longer reads policies from the old manifest file; everything moves to the central policy service. Support should expect customer tickets about "skipped purge" warnings during the first cycle — these are benign and clear after one full sweep. Before closing this step, confirm the sweeper restarts cleanly with the values shown below.

config for hahip-kaguf:
[holath]
port = 8443
region = north-4
host = holath.tolvaqlabs.internal
timeout_ms = 1000
retries = 2